  • Viruses, bacteria, fungi and protozoa all want to infect your body and don't mind if they kill you so long as you pass on the infection.

    John Tregoning is reader in respiratory infections at Imperial College London. His research focuses on how virus and bacteria infect our lungs. He has published over 60 academic papers, collectively cited over 3,500 times. He is also well-established writer on academic careers, regularly writing commissioned articles for Times Higher Education, has a weekly column in Nature and has also published in Science. A recent article was viewed over 100,000 times and was in the top 150 most discussed articles of the year. Dr Tregoning remains at the forefront of infectious diseases research and is based at Imperial College London where he runs a research group. He has presented his work at the Pint of Science festival as well as being invited to speak at conferences and universities both in the UK and overseas. Amongst other outlets, he has been interviewed by the BBC, Bloomberg and The Sunday Telegraph.

    R is not the same as R0. Both the R's stand for Replication rate for a particular vial infection but while R can change depending on the levels of immunity and various preventative measures, R0 is always the same for any particular virus or bacterium. R0 is the "starting value" for R. The rate of reproduction (new infections from one infected person) when there is no immunity at all and no protective measures at all. Just the way the virus likes it in fact. For each pathogen, R0 is this always bigger than R. The zero indicates it's the initial value, a shorthand mathematicians often use, but you can imagine it means zero resistance and you won't be wrong.
